Angélique Kidjo Share a Special Moment With Lupita Nyong’o

Three-time Grammy winner Angélique Kidjo over the weekend returned to Carnegie Hall with an all-star band and some very special guests for the debut performance of her reimagined take on the Talking Heads’ classic 1980 album, Remain in Light.

Kidjo took unforgettable songs such as Crosseyed and Painless, Once in a Lifetime, and Born Under Punches (The Heat Goes On), reinterpreting them with electrifying rhythms, African guitars, and layered backing vocals.

The New York band’s fourth album was a career peak, and used musical influences and rhythms from West Africa to forge a vibrant new direction for rock.

Gracing the event was Kenyan Oscar winner Lupita Nyong’o, who shared a pic of the two on her Instagram, with the caption, “Angelique Kidjo, you are in the slayage business! Amazing performance at #CarnegieHall.”
